Booklet compiled by the Public Affairs Research Council of Lousiana regarding the forms of municipal government in Louisiana, prompted by an increasing interest in making improvements to local governments, as the population became more urbanized and some cities were plagued with dishonest officials. While changing the form of government was not offered as as a cure-all for the problems facing municipalities in the publication, potential change presented the opportunity of creating a structure more conducive to efficient and effective operation. 12 pages.
